CFTC rule definition
CFTC rule means a regulation or order of the commodity futures trading commission in effect on July 1, 1990, and all subsequent amendments, additions or other revisions to the regulation or order, unless the administrator, within ten days following the effective date of the amendment, addition, or revision, disallows the application to this chapter in whole or in part by rule or order.

Examples of CFTC rule in a sentence
The lending of securities to an IB under a subordinated loan agreement is not recognized under CFTC rule 1.17(h), and the resulting liability will not be excluded from liabilities in calculating net capital.
